Convocation-2012
The most prestigious event of the College of Engineering Roorkee (COER) the 9th Convocation was commemorated with great pomp and show on Saturday, March 17, 2012. A total of 766 students were awarded their Graduate and Post Graduate degrees. 8 students were awarded Gold medals and another 8 students the Silver medals for scoring top positions in their courses at the university examinations.
Professor D. P. Agrawal, Chairman, Union Public Services Commission (UPSC) was the Chief Guest on the occasion. During his lecture he pointed out that market trends are changing these days, a bright career and successful life demands “Marketable Skills” from our youth and the responsibility lies on the shoulders of educational institutions. He explained that there is no doubt College of Engineering Roorkee (COER) produces a number of good quality engineers every year, who not only pursue good careers but prove to be good human beings throughout! Recalling a quote from Swami Vivekananda he elucidated that education helps in discovery of the inner self. The real knowledge, he added lies within ‘No knowledge comes from Outside, it is all inside’ as Swami Vivekananda believed. He further, suggested the students to use their education for self discovery and self analysis.
Professor D. S. Chauhan, Vice-Chancellor, Uttarakhand Technical University, presided over the function. Congratulating the degree recipients and their parents on their achievements he suggested that they must continuously strive to find new ideas and creative ways of handling various situations. Life today is so unpredictable that it needs ‘re-tooling and re-engineering’ everyday. Change is inevitable, but how to mould that change according to our own preferences and requirements is real “Engineering in real sense”. He further advised the students to be perpetual learners because learning offers opportunities to improve and leads to excellence.
COER Chairman, Mr. J. C. Jain welcomed all the dignitaries. 3 students - Riti Arora, Amzad and Tanvi Taneja were awarded Seth Roshan Lal Jain Trophy for being the overall topper in a particular course. Director General COER, Dr. Gopal Ranjan, presented the report related to achievements, during the past one year. On behalf of the COER family he congratulated Prabhjot Singh, B.Tech (4th Year) Computer Science, who scored 39th All India Rank with 99.97 percentile in GATE-2012 examination also 16 COERian, who also scored above 99 percentile in the same examination.
He indicated that during the last 14 years COER has made a mark in the academic world. The credit goes to intelligent COERians, dedicated faculty and multidimensional support of management. The industry institute interaction through projects, summer training has been very useful. The university merit positions secured by COERians are memorable.
COER Trustee Mr. Shreyance Jain, COER Secretary Mr. Subhash Jain, Dean (Student Welfare and Admin) Col G. S. Bisht also shared their ideas and views with the students on the Convocation day.
